(en) ECC (Elliptic Curve Cryptosystem)

A method for creating public key algorithms, which some experts claim provides the highest strength-per-bit of any cryptosystem known today. Its algorithms accept an encryption key but then add extra numbers representing the coordinates of points on an imaginary wiggly curve as it crosses an imaginary line. Its complicated algebraic approach allows shorter keys to produce security equivalent to longer keys in other cryptosystems (such as RSA). Shorter keys mean the encryption and decryption can be performed relatively quickly and with less computer hardware. Numerous experts believe ECC will eventually enjoy widespread use.
